Kylie Jenner has come under fire for posting after which deleting a photograph on Instagram showing her support for Israel following a Hamas attack that killed tons of.
Jenner, 26, shared the photo from the pro-Israel account @StandWithUs, which features the Israeli flag and reads, “Now and all the time, we stand with the people of Israel!”
The youngest Jenner deleted the Instagram Story post inside an hour, following backlash from a few of her 400 million Instagram followers.
